Parameter | Description |
Consumer Applications | Specifies the applications for which the masking criterion has to be applied. Start typing the application name, select the application from the type-ahead search results displayed, and click to add one or more applications. You can use the delete icon to delete the added applications from the list. |
XPath. Specifies the masking criteria for XPath expressions in the error messages. | |
Masking Criteria | Click Add masking criteria and provide the following information and click Add: Masking Type. Specifies the type of masking required. You select either Mask or Filter. Query expression. Specify the query expression that has to be masked or filtered. For example: /soapenv:Fault/faultstring Mask Value. This is available if masking type selected is Mask. Provide a mask value. For example: Error occurred while processing the request. Please check your input request or any other meaningful message or string. Note: You can add multiple masking criteria. Namespace. Specifies the following Namespace information: Namespace Prefix. The namespace prefix of the payload expression to be validated. Namespace URI. The namespace URI of the payload expression to be validated Note: You can add multiple namespace prefix and URI by clicking . |
JPath. This is applicable only for REST API. Specifies the masking criteria for JPath expressions in the error messages. | |
Masking Criteria | Click Add masking criteria and provide the following information and click Add: Masking Type. Specifies the type of masking required. You select either Mask or Filter. Query expression. Specify the query expression that has to be masked or filtered. For example: $.error.reason Mask Value. This is available if masking type selected is Mask. Provide a mask value. For example: Error occurred while processing the request. Please check your input request or any other meaningful message or string. |
Regex. Specifies the masking criteria for regular expressions in the error messages. | |
Masking Criteria | Click Add masking criteria and provide the following information and click Add: Masking Type. Specifies the type of masking required. You select either Mask or Filter. Query expression. Specify the query expression that has to be masked or filtered. For example: (.*) Mask Value. This is available if masking type selected is Mask. Provide a mask value. For example: Error occurred while processing the request. Please check your input request or any other meaningful message or string. |
Apply for transaction Logging | Select this option to apply masking criteria for transactional logs. When you select this option the transactional log for the response is masked on top of response sent to the client. |
Apply for payload | Select this option to apply masking criteria for payload. When you select this option the payload in the response sent to the client is masked. Note: When you select this option it automatically masks the data in the transactional log. |